Arizona Rewrites Immigration Law to Prevent Racial Profiling

Arizona lawmakers have approved several changes to the recently passed sweeping law targeting illegal immigration. One change to the bill strengthens restrictions against using race or ethnicity as the basis for questioning and inserts those same restrictions in other parts of the law.
